Spent New Year's Eve swilling beer and socializing at the Outlaw's place in the quiet town of Frederick, MD. A good gathering of people, mostly cyclists in one or another capacity. Brewed libations ranged from all manner of micros in the fridge to four Corney kegs chilling on the back patio: Loose Cannon Hop3 Ale and Holy Sheet Über Abbey Ale (courtesy of SSOFT-sponsor Clipper City), and the Outlaw's own Bukowski's Breakfast Stout and Bad Santa Holiday Ale. Tasty, tasty, tasty, all.

After most of the partygoers headed out post-midnight, a small group of us remained, huddled around our laptops in the Outlaw's living room to while away the time until that other magic hour: 3:00 a.m.

That's midnight, Cali time. It's also the time when registration opened for the Single Speed World Championship '08, to be held in Napa on August 23 and 24. With the big hand on 12 and the little hand on 3, we sent several registrations through the air with hopes that we would all somehow beat out the other 1,000+ people doing likewise at that very moment.

Now, it's all in the hands of Aubrey McFate. Good luck to all who responded (even if I don't really mean it, ha). Seven to ten days is gonna feel like an eternity...*

Be always drunk.
That's all there is to it--
it's the only way.
So as not to feel
the horrible burden of time
that breaks your back
and bends you to the earth,
you have to be continually drunk.

But on what?
Wine, poetry or virtue, as you wish.
But be drunk.

And if sometimes,
on the steps of a palace
or the green grass of a ditch,
in the mournful solitude of your room,
you wake again,
drunkenness already diminishing or gone,
ask the wind,
the wave,
the star,
the bird,
the clock,
everything that is flying,
everything that is groaning,
everything that is rolling,
everything that is singing,
everything that is speaking. . .
ask what time it is
and wind, wave, star, bird, clock
will answer you:
"It is time to be drunk!
So as not to be the martyred slaves of time,
be drunk,
be continually drunk!
On wine, on poetry, or on virtue as you wish."

                         —Charles Baudelaire, Be Drunk
